About MARTYR ART
MARTYR ART is an Alternative Industrial Metal band, founded in 2004 by Joe Gagliardi III in Mountainville, NY.
As its main producer, singer, songwriter, multi-instrumentalist, and visual artist, Gagliardi is the only official member of Martyr Art and remains solely responsible for its direction.
Martyr Arts’ music infuses a wide range of genres including Thrash, Electronic, Goth, Progressive, Djent, Groove, Grunge, Punk, Orchestral and Noise.
Often, live performances vary from a stripped-down solo performance, to a full-fledged band and anything else in-between. On stage, Martyr Art also employs visual elements such as banners and digital projections to accompany performances.
Since 2004, Martyr Art has released five full-length albums, with the most recent being the critically-acclaimed “Distorted Interpretations” (released in 2013). Martyr Art has also remixed other established (and signed) artists including State of The Union, Aesthetic Perfection, 16 Volt and Juno Reactor.
Martyr Art has opened for national acts KMFDM and DJ Accucrack, Co-Headlined the 2012 Farmageddon Music Festival in Saugerties, NY and headlined the 2014 Newburgh Illuminated Music Festival in Newburgh, NY. Martyr Art has also appeared in three consecutive issues of Guitar World Magazine (Jan-March 2011) in advertisements for Pick Guy Guitar Picks along side John 5 (Rob Zombie) and Suicide Silence.
Martyr Art is currently endorsed by Clayton Custom Guitar Picks.
